Output 743a581bb07688b96d0c528b63cd8c8fceacd3cbc832e48b070fdb94c838d082:25

value
465420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a8cd1d229533ea7c0f8359f82c255931b772403 OP_EQUAL
address
372bozGSLBRrcu4RKk3dUrDGyWcLUXfXsi
transaction
743a581bb07688b96d0c528b63cd8c8fceacd3cbc832e48b070fdb94c838d082
confirmations
138857
spent
true